How they compare
Saudi Arabia currently reports 36,175 current USD per square kilometre against 967.57 current USD per square kilometre in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income), a difference of 35,207 current USD per square kilometre.
That makes Saudi Arabia's figure about 37.4 times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income)'s.
Across all 57 years both countries report, Saudi Arabia has been ahead every year.
Saudi Arabia ranks 36th and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income) ranks 37th of 166 countries.
Saudi Arabia has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Saudi Arabia | Sub-Saharan Africa (excluding high income)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 120.93 current USD per square kilometre | 41.87 current USD per square kilometre | 79.06 current USD per square kilometre | Saudi Arabia |
| 1970s | 3,068 current USD per square kilometre | 225.51 current USD per square kilometre | 2,842 current USD per square kilometre | Saudi Arabia |
| 1980s | 9,045 current USD per square kilometre | 420.82 current USD per square kilometre | 8,624 current USD per square kilometre | Saudi Arabia |
| 1990s | 7,566 current USD per square kilometre | 350.35 current USD per square kilometre | 7,216 current USD per square kilometre | Saudi Arabia |
| 2000s | 12,517 current USD per square kilometre | 506.87 current USD per square kilometre | 12,010 current USD per square kilometre | Saudi Arabia |
| 2010s | 30,669 current USD per square kilometre | 838.25 current USD per square kilometre | 29,831 current USD per square kilometre | Saudi Arabia |
| 2020s | 32,149 current USD per square kilometre | 896.03 current USD per square kilometre | 31,253 current USD per square kilometre | Saudi Arabia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Military expenditure (current USD) div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
